pytests: sid_strings: do not fail if epoch ending has zeros
To avoid collisions in random OID strings, we started using the epoch date modulus 100 million. The trouble is we did not strip out the leading zeros, so the field might be '00000123' when it should be '123', if the date happened not to correspond to an epoch with a zero in the eighth to last place. This has been the case for most of the last 1041 days, but fortunately the bug was only introduced earlier this year.
